Course Content

• Principles of Food Storage and Preservation
• Hazard Analysis and Critical Control Points (HACCP) in Food Preservation
• Food Microbiology and Spoilage Mechanisms
• Thermal Processing: Canning, Pasteurization, and Sterilization
• Non-Thermal Processing: Irradiation, High Pressure Processing, and Pulsed Electric Fields
• Refrigerated and Frozen Food Storage: Temperature Control and Quality Management
• Food Packaging Materials and their Impact on Shelf Life
• Food Waste Reduction and Sustainability Practices in Food Storage
• Food Safety Regulations and Compliance
• Sensory Evaluation and Quality Assessment of Preserved Foods

Career path

Career Role Description
Food Preservation Technologist Develops and implements food preservation techniques, ensuring food safety and quality. High demand for expertise in food storage and preservation methods.
Quality Control Manager (Food Industry) Oversees food quality and safety throughout the production process. Storage and preservation knowledge is crucial for compliance.
Supply Chain Manager (Food & Beverage) Manages logistics, including efficient storage and transportation of perishable goods. Understanding preservation techniques optimizes efficiency.
Food Safety Officer Ensures adherence to food safety regulations, including correct storage and handling practices. Expertise in preservation methods is advantageous.

An Executive Certificate in Food Storage and Preservation is increasingly significant in today's UK market, driven by rising consumer demand for sustainable and ethically sourced food. The UK food industry faces considerable challenges, including minimizing food waste and ensuring food safety. According to WRAP, approximately 6.6 million tonnes of household food waste were generated in the UK in 2018. This highlights the urgent need for professionals skilled in effective food preservation techniques.
